The global gift box market is experiencing robust growth, driven by rising consumer demand for premium packaging in gifting occasions, e-commerce expansion, and increasing emphasis on sustainability. According to Grand View Research, the global gift packaging market was valued at USD 68.4 billion in 2022 and is expected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.8% from 2023 to 2030. This growth is further fueled by trends in personalized gifting and the proliferation of subscription services, which rely heavily on aesthetically pleasing and durable packaging solutions. H2: 2026 Market Trends for Gift Boxes

The global gift box market is poised for significant transformation by 2026, driven by evolving consumer preferences, sustainability demands, and technological advancements. As e-commerce continues to expand and personalization becomes a key differentiator, several prominent trends are expected to shape the industry.

  1. Sustainable and Eco-Friendly Packaging
    Environmental consciousness will dominate packaging choices in 2026. Consumers and brands alike are prioritizing recyclable, biodegradable, and compostable materials. Expect widespread adoption of FSC-certified paperboard, plant-based inks, and minimalistic designs that reduce waste. Brands will increasingly highlight their eco-credentials on packaging to appeal to environmentally aware buyers.

  2. Customization and Personalization
    Mass customization will be a major growth driver. Advances in digital printing and AI-driven design tools will enable affordable, on-demand personalization of gift boxes—featuring names, photos, messages, or themed artwork. This trend will be especially strong in premium and luxury segments, where emotional connection enhances perceived value.

  3. Rise of Subscription and Experience-Based Gifting
    Subscription gift boxes, particularly in niches like wellness, gourmet foods, self-care, and hobbies, will gain traction. These curated experiences offer ongoing value and foster customer loyalty. By 2026, expect more interactive and seasonal themes, often tied to holidays or cultural events, to keep subscribers engaged.

  4. E-Commerce Optimization
    With online shopping remaining dominant, gift boxes will be designed for durability and visual appeal during shipping. Features like tamper-evident seals, easy assembly, and unboxing experiences optimized for social media sharing will be critical. Retailers will integrate gift boxing options directly into checkout flows, making gifting seamless.

  5. Smart Packaging Integration
    Innovative brands may adopt smart packaging elements such as QR codes, NFC tags, or augmented reality (AR) to enhance interactivity. These technologies can provide gift recipients with videos, messages, or product information, creating a memorable and immersive experience.

  6. Regional and Cultural Customization
    As global markets expand, gift boxes will reflect regional tastes and traditions. Localized designs, colors, and motifs will become essential for international brands aiming to resonate with diverse audiences during festivals like Diwali, Lunar New Year, or Christmas.

  7. Premiumization and Luxury Appeal
    Consumers are willing to pay more for high-quality, aesthetically pleasing gift boxes—especially for corporate gifting and special occasions. Expect growth in textured finishes, embossing, foil stamping, and luxury inserts like fabric liners or magnetic closures.

In summary, the 2026 gift box market will be defined by sustainability, personalization, digital integration, and emotional engagement. Companies that embrace these trends will be better positioned to capture consumer interest and drive long-term brand loyalty.

Common Pitfalls When Sourcing Gift Boxes: Quality and Intellectual Property Issues

Sourcing gift boxes from suppliers—especially overseas—can be cost-effective, but it comes with significant risks if not managed carefully. Two major areas where businesses often encounter problems are product quality and intellectual property (IP) protection. Overlooking these aspects can lead to customer dissatisfaction, reputational damage, legal disputes, and financial losses.

Quality-Related Pitfalls

Inconsistent Material and Construction

One of the most frequent quality issues is inconsistency in materials and build. Suppliers may use lower-grade paperboard, incorrect coatings, or substandard adhesives to cut costs. This can result in flimsy boxes that warp, tear easily, or fail to protect the contents. Without clear specifications and third-party inspections, buyers may receive batches that vary significantly in durability and appearance.

Poor Print and Finish Quality

Gift boxes are often chosen for their aesthetic appeal, making print accuracy vital. Common problems include color mismatches, misaligned printing, blurry logos, and uneven finishes (e.g., spot UV or foil stamping). These defects may stem from low-quality printing equipment or lack of color calibration. Without approved physical samples (known as “golden samples”), it’s difficult to ensure consistency across production runs.

Lack of Durability Testing

Many suppliers do not perform adequate drop tests, compression tests, or moisture resistance checks. As a result, boxes may collapse during shipping or degrade in humid conditions. Buyers should specify required performance standards and verify that suppliers conduct proper testing before shipment.

Inadequate Packaging and Handling

Even high-quality boxes can be damaged during transit if not packed properly. Suppliers may skimp on internal dividers, corner protectors, or sturdy master cartons. This leads to crushed or scratched boxes upon arrival, especially in long international shipments.

Intellectual Property-Related Pitfalls

Unauthorized Use of Branding or Designs

A major risk is that suppliers may reproduce your custom-designed gift boxes for other clients or sell them on the gray market. Without robust contractual protections, your unique packaging design could be copied, diluting your brand identity and potentially leading to counterfeit products.

Weak or Unenforceable IP Clauses in Contracts

Many sourcing agreements lack clear language assigning ownership of design rights or prohibiting third-party use. Verbal assurances are not enough—IP rights must be explicitly defined and protected in writing, ideally under the jurisdiction of your home country.

Supplier Ownership of Tooling and Molds

In some cases, suppliers retain ownership of custom dies, molds, or printing plates used to produce your gift boxes. This gives them leverage and may allow them to recreate your design without permission. Always ensure that tooling is either purchased outright or clearly licensed for your exclusive use.

Difficulty Enforcing IP Rights Overseas

Even with a strong contract, enforcing IP rights in certain countries can be slow, costly, or impractical. Jurisdictional challenges and varying legal standards mean that legal recourse may not be effective. Proactive measures, such as watermarking designs, limiting production visibility, and working with trusted suppliers, are essential.

Mitigation Strategies

To avoid these pitfalls, businesses should:
– Require detailed product specifications and approve physical prototypes.
– Conduct third-party quality inspections before shipment.
– Use legally reviewed contracts with explicit IP ownership and confidentiality clauses.
– Retain ownership of custom tooling and design files.
– Partner with reputable suppliers and consider using sourcing agents with local expertise.

By addressing quality and IP concerns proactively, companies can protect their brand, ensure customer satisfaction, and maintain a competitive edge in the marketplace.

Logistics & Compliance Guide for Gift Box

Product Classification & Regulations

Ensure the gift box and its contents are properly classified under the appropriate Harmonized System (HS) code for international shipping. Each item inside (e.g., food, cosmetics, textiles) may be subject to specific regulations. Verify compliance with destination country requirements, including labeling, ingredients, and safety standards (e.g., FDA for food in the U.S., CE marking in the EU).

Packaging & Labeling Requirements

Use durable, tamper-evident packaging suitable for the contents. Clearly label each gift box with:
– Product name and description
– Net weight or item count
– Manufacturer or distributor information
– Country of origin
– Batch/lot number and expiration date (if applicable)
– Compliance marks (e.g., FSC for sustainable paper, CE, FDA)
Include multilingual labeling if shipping internationally.

Restricted & Prohibited Items

Avoid including items restricted by carriers or destination countries. Common prohibitions include:
– Perishable food without proper preservation
– Alcohol or tobacco (subject to strict import controls)
– Lithium batteries (unless properly packaged per IATA rules)
– Flammable or pressurized contents (e.g., aerosols)
Always consult carrier guidelines and local customs regulations.

Shipping & Handling

Choose a logistics partner experienced in handling gift boxes, especially for seasonal peaks. Ensure boxes meet dimensional and weight limits for standard shipping methods. Use appropriate cushioning to prevent damage in transit. For international shipments, provide accurate commercial invoices and packing lists.

Import/Export Documentation

Prepare all necessary documentation, including:
– Commercial invoice with detailed item descriptions and values
– Packing list
– Certificate of Origin (if required)
– Phytosanitary certificate (for plant-based materials)
Ensure declared values reflect fair market price to avoid customs delays or penalties.

Sustainability & Environmental Compliance

Adhere to environmental regulations such as the EU Packaging Waste Directive or U.S. state-level recycling laws. Use recyclable or biodegradable materials where possible. Clearly mark packaging with recycling symbols and avoid excessive plastic use to meet evolving sustainability standards.

Returns & Reverse Logistics

Establish a clear returns policy for damaged, defective, or unwanted gift boxes. Design packaging to support reuse or easy recycling. Comply with “right of withdrawal” laws (e.g., 14-day return window in the EU under consumer protection rules).

Recordkeeping & Traceability

Maintain detailed records of sourcing, manufacturing, and shipping for at least 3–5 years. Ensure batch-level traceability to support recalls or compliance audits. Implement a system to track compliance certifications for all components.
